Abstract:The traffic bottleneck effects are investigated on a ring road with up- and down-slopes to the semi-discrete model under the Lagrange coordinate. The kinetic wave theory is applied to discuss all types of stationary solutions for a small relaxation time. Moreover, the analytical formulas of the queuing lengths before bottlenecks and the critical densities of the saturated flux are derived.
